Brampton Station is a minimalist affair, focusing on the essentials for rail travel without overwhelming distractions. Here, you'll find that there's no ticket office or machines, so be sure to plan ahead by purchasing and printing your tickets in advance or opting for digital tickets via the relevant train service apps. However, the station does accommodate tech-savvy travellers with smartcard validators for ease of access.
Step-free access is a key feature, ensuring inclusion and mobility for all passengers. Thanks to step-free access via the platform-end ramp, travelling to and from Ipswich and Lowestoft is hassle-free. Although accessibility is at the forefront, you'll need to adjust your expectations when it comes to onboard luxuries—there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, so prepare accordingly. For security, CCTV keeps watch, offering peace of mind for passengers, while customer help points provide any additional support you might require.
Despite its quaintness, getting beyond Brampton Station is a breeze with nearby connections that can whisk you away to surrounding locales. However, do note that the station doesn't serve rail replacement bus services. Instead, travellers are directed to nearby Beccles or Halesworth stations for such needs. If you're cycling to the station, there's a cycle stand located conveniently close, ideal for short waits. The station provides essential facilities for travelers, ensuring a comfortable journey. The ticket office operates from early morning until early afternoon on Saturdays, though it remains closed during weekdays and Sundays. However, you can still purchase tickets or collect pre-purchased tickets from the accessible ticket machines located on-site. It's worth noting that smartcards are supported at the station, aligning with modern, streamlined travel conveniences.
For those with specific accessibility needs, Alderley Edge station offers partial step-free access and is categorized as a scooter-friendly location, making it navigable for those using mobility aids. There's no waiting room available, yet the station ensures passenger security with the presence of CCTV. Unfortunately, facilities such as restrooms, baby changing rooms, and refreshment outlets are not provided, so plan accordingly.
Beyond the station itself, Alderley Edge is well-connected through various transport links. Although direct bicycle hire services aren't available, the station provides limited bicycle storage facilities for those traveling with bikes. For taxi services, visitors can arrange their rides using online platforms such as Cab4You. Bus services are also in operation with convenient stops nearby, allowing for easy intermodal transfer.
